Be not rash with thy mouth, and let not thine heart be hasty to utter any thing before God: for God is in heaven, and thou upon earth: therefore let thy words be few.

General references

Bible References

Not rash

Genesis 18:27
Then Abraham answered and said, "Look, please, I was bold to speak to my Lord, but I [am] dust and ashes.
Genesis 28:20
And Jacob made a vow saying, "If God will be with me and protect me on this way that I am going, and gives me food to eat and clothing to wear,
Numbers 30:2
if a man makes a vow for Yahweh or swears an oath with a binding pledge on himself, he must not render his word invalid; he must do all that went out from his mouth.
Judges 11:30
And Jephthah made a vow to Yahweh, and he said, "If indeed you will give the {Ammonites} into my hand,
1 Samuel 14:24
Now the men of Israel were hard pressed on that day, because Saul had made the army take an oath, saying, "Cursed be the man who eats [any] food until evening, when I will have avenged myself on my enemies!" So none of the army tasted [any] food.
Mark 6:23
And he swore to her, "Anything whatever you ask me for I will give you, up to half my kingdom!"

For

Psalm 115:3
But our God [is] in the heavens; all that he desires, he does.
Isaiah 55:9
"For [as] [the] heavens are {higher} than [the] earth, so my ways are {higher} than your ways, and my thoughts than your thoughts.
Matthew 6:9
Therefore you pray in this way: "Our Father who is in heaven, may your name be treated as holy.

Let thy

Ecclesiastes 5:3
For a dream comes with many cares, and the voice of a fool with many words.
Proverbs 10:19
In many words, transgression is not lacking, but he who restrains his lips is prudent.
Matthew 6:7
"But [when you] pray, do not babble repetitiously like the pagans, for they think that because of their many words they will be heard.
James 3:2
For we all stumble [in] many [ways]. If anyone does not stumble in what he says, he [is] a perfect individual, able to hold in check his whole body also.
